Net Promoter Score Definition: Your Key to Customer Loyalty Insights

Userpilot

Dive into the Net Promoter Score definition to discover mirror customer sentiment and how it can help redefine your business strategy. NPS assesses how customers feel by posing one direct question: “On a scale from 0 to 10, how likely are you to recommend our company’s product or service?”
